Use the /clips resource as the primary clipping path. It wraps ingest, transcription, suggestion generation, layout, captions, and QA into a single state machine driven by next_action. The agent follows next_action rather than orchestrating individual stages.
The low-level staged endpoints (suggestion apply, preview-frames, timeline/media-views, etc.) exist for manual-control scenarios but should not be used unless the /clips resource cannot produce the result.
| Method | Path | Purpose |
|---|---|---|
| POST | /clips | Create a clip run from an asset or YouTube URL |
| GET | /clips/{clip_id} | Poll state — auto-advances through all stages |
| POST | /clips/{clip_id}/reselect | Change suggestion or set absolute time range |
| POST | /clips/{clip_id}/repair | Run one bounded repair pass |
| POST | /clips/{clip_id}/export | Export a clip that is ready |
Before creating a clip, let the user choose which segment to clip. This avoids wasting an API call on content the user doesn't want.
Ingest and wait for suggestions. Create the clip with selection_mode: "auto_best" and poll until source.suggestions_status = "ready". The first poll response with suggestions will include selection.alternatives.
Present suggestions to the user. Show the ranked list from selection.alternatives:
If the user picks a different suggestion than auto_best selected, call POST /clips/{clip_id}/reselect with selection_mode: "suggestion" and the chosen suggestion_id.
If the user provides manual timestamps, call POST /clips/{clip_id}/reselect with selection_mode: "time_range" and the absolute start_seconds + end_seconds.
Continue the normal poll loop — follow next_action until export.
If the user says "just pick the best one" or doesn't express a preference, skip step 2 and let auto_best proceed.

Follow next_action, not assumptions: the clip resource's state machine handles stage sequencing internally. Asset existence does not mean transcript, suggestions, or analysis are ready — syncClip checks each gate on every poll and auto-advances when ready.
One repair pass, then reselect: the system caps automatic repair at one pass because repeated retries accumulate planner fallbacks (more letterbox segments) and degrade quality. After one repair, if QA still blocks, next_action switches to "reselect" so a different suggestion or time range can be tried.
Captions are clip-window-aware by default: the clip resource applies captions scoped to the selected clip window. Source transcripts can span an entire hour — without scoping, a 90-second short would render captions from unrelated parts of the video.
Letterbox rejection for podcasts: when layout_mode is "auto" and the planner can't achieve split/focus layouts (insufficient dual-speaker evidence), it rejects rather than silently exporting a low-quality letterboxed podcast clip.
Duration has three sources: asset metadata (often wrong — reports full video length even after trimming), suggestion timing, and transcript timing. canonical_duration_seconds takes the max of all three to avoid clipping content.
